ABOUT US

Our mission: Eradicate health disparities by empowering the teams who care for underserved families.

BridgeHealthAI partners with Federally Qualified Health Centers (FQHCs) and community organizations to ensure every patient gets the care and benefits they deserve without drowning care teams in paperwork.

Our platform automates high-friction tasks like outreach, insurance verification, eligibility checks, follow-ups, referrals, and scheduling. With modern AI and automation, we help teams close care gaps faster, protect revenue, reduce administrative burden, and stay focused on patients.

Born out of Harvard and MIT and backed by Pear VC, Flare Capital, and Glen Tullman (founder of Livongo), BridgeHealthAI is a fast-growing, seed-stage company trusted by leading community health centers. We are purpose-built for the safety net, helping clinics scale access, reduce burnout, and deliver equitable care for the 30M+ patients served by FQHCs each year.

THE ROLE

We're looking for a Senior Product Manager with 5+ years of product management experience and meaningful experience in healthcare or health tech to help us turn complex healthcare operations into simple, scalable products.

This is a highly hands-on, customer-facing product role. You'll work directly with health center executives, frontline teams, engineers, operations, and the founders to deeply understand problems, identify what we should build, and drive products from discovery through launch and iteration.

You'll be in the room with our customers. You'll lead working sessions, understand how their workflows operate today, identify where things break down, and work alongside them to design better ways of working. You'll turn those conversations into product ideas and clear product direction, bring concepts back to customers for feedback, and partner closely with engineering to bring the best solutions to life.

Our customers operate in complex environments where workflows often span patients, staff, payers, EHRs, external systems, phone calls, spreadsheets, and manual follow-up. Your job is to make that complexity feel simple.

You won't manage a backlog from a distance. You'll talk to users, map workflows, make product decisions, write clear requirements, test ideas, and stay close to customers after launch to make sure what we build actually works.

You'll have significant ownership over our product as we scale from high-value workflows into a broader platform for healthcare administrative automation.

WHAT YOU'LL DO

- Own products and workflows end-to-end, from customer discovery and problem definition through development, launch, measurement, and iteration.

- Lead product conversations directly with customers, including healthcare executives, operational leaders, and frontline staff.

- Co-design solutions with customers. Understand how work happens today, identify where it can improve, and translate real operational problems into better workflows and product experiences.

- Facilitate ambiguous customer conversations and create clarity. Ask the right questions, surface the real problem, align on the desired future state, and determine what the product team should do next.

- Turn customer conversations into scalable product direction, separating individual feature requests from broader problems and identifying patterns across customers.

- Prototype and test ideas quickly. Put concepts in front of users, gather feedback, and iterate before and after launch.

- Translate complex healthcare operations into intuitive products that reduce administrative burden and make it easier for teams to get work done.

- Partner closely with engineering to translate customer and business needs into clear product requirements and make thoughtful tradeoffs around scope, usability, speed, and reliability.

- Map current-state and future-state workflows, including the people, systems, decisions, handoffs, and exceptions involved.

- Define and track success metrics and use product data, operational outcomes, and customer feedback to understand what's working and where we should improve.

- Prioritize thoughtfully, balancing customer needs, product strategy, engineering capacity, scalability, and business impact.

- Stay close to implementation and adoption. The job doesn't stop when something ships; you'll work with customers and internal teams to understand how products perform in the real world and continuously improve them.

- Help shape the broader product strategy and roadmap as BridgeHealthAI grows.
